Indy’s sweltering this week—nearly 91 degrees, with heat and humidity dominating, though some southern Indiana areas got a welcome rain shower. But relief is on the way: a cold front drops temps into the 50s Wednesday morning and pushes highs into the 70s through Friday. Meanwhile, Tropical Storm Bertha’s brewing along the Gulf Coast with 70 mph winds and 2-4 inches of rain expected. Back home, the heat’s staging a comeback by Sunday with 90s—perfect for the big race. Grab the break while you can, summer’s not done yet.
